How Life Works Here
Smyth Court is located in West Northamptonshire, near Northampton. Crime rates are above average, with 216 incidents recorded in 12 months. Violence and sexual offences is the most frequent category. Violent offences make up 50% of reports.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. The nearest transport stop is 46m away (bus). Rail links may require a connecting journey. The median property price is £165,000. Based on 2 transactions recorded since 2014. Rented accommodation predominates. There are 12 schools within 2 km, 12 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. 3 are rated Outstanding.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 158m away. Note that above-average crime in the area may offset the school accessibility for families. Overall, this street scores 44 out of 100 for liveability, slightly below the district average.
